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$1,059 per month in Qatif vs $1,017 in Medellin, rent included.

A couple spends around $1,673 per month in Qatif vs $1,602 in Medellin, rent included.

A family of three spends $2,288 per month in Qatif vs $2,188 in Medellin, rent included.

Qatif costs about 4% more than Medellin, driven mainly by Sport & Entertainment.

Both Qatif and Medellin are more affordable than the global median – Qatif 21% lower, Medellin 24% lower.

Cost Breakdown

A central one-bedroom costs $361 in Qatif versus $482 in Medellin.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.

Salaries run about 327% higher in Qatif, which partly offsets the higher cost of living there. Purchasing power depends on which expenses matter most to you.

A mid-range dinner for two costs $47.00 in Qatif versus $33.00 in Medellin. Groceries tell a different story – $173 in Qatif vs $190 in Medellin – so Qatif wins on supermarket bills even if dining out costs more.
